| #include "src/sksl/ir/SkSLVariableReference.h" |
| |
| #include "src/sksl/SkSLIRGenerator.h" |
| #include "src/sksl/ir/SkSLConstructor.h" |
| #include "src/sksl/ir/SkSLFloatLiteral.h" |
| #include "src/sksl/ir/SkSLSetting.h" |
| |
| namespace SkSL { |
| |
| VariableReference::VariableReference(int offset, const Variable* variable, RefKind refKind) |
| : INHERITED(offset, kExpressionKind, &variable->type()) |
| , fVariable(variable) |
| , fRefKind(refKind) { |
| SkASSERT(fVariable); |
| if (refKind != kRead_RefKind) { |
| fVariable->fWriteCount++; |
| } |
| if (refKind != kWrite_RefKind) { |
| fVariable->fReadCount++; |
| } |
| } |
| |
| VariableReference::~VariableReference() { |
| if (fRefKind != kRead_RefKind) { |
| fVariable->fWriteCount--; |
| } |
| if (fRefKind != kWrite_RefKind) { |
| fVariable->fReadCount--; |
| } |
| } |
| |
| void VariableReference::setRefKind(RefKind refKind) { |
| if (fRefKind != kRead_RefKind) { |
| fVariable->fWriteCount--; |
| } |
| if (fRefKind != kWrite_RefKind) { |
| fVariable->fReadCount--; |
| } |
| if (refKind != kRead_RefKind) { |
| fVariable->fWriteCount++; |
| } |
| if (refKind != kWrite_RefKind) { |
| fVariable->fReadCount++; |
| } |
| fRefKind = refKind; |
| } |
| |
| std::unique_ptr<Expression> VariableReference::constantPropagate(const IRGenerator& irGenerator, |
| const DefinitionMap& definitions) { |
| if (fRefKind != kRead_RefKind) { |
| return nullptr; |
| } |
| if ((fVariable->fModifiers.fFlags & Modifiers::kConst_Flag) && fVariable->fInitialValue && |
| fVariable->fInitialValue->isCompileTimeConstant() && |
| this->type().typeKind() != Type::TypeKind::kArray) { |
| return fVariable->fInitialValue->clone(); |
| } |
| auto exprIter = definitions.find(fVariable); |
| if (exprIter != definitions.end() && exprIter->second && |
| (*exprIter->second)->isCompileTimeConstant()) { |
| return (*exprIter->second)->clone(); |
| } |
| return nullptr; |
| } |
| |
| } // namespace SkSL |
